2026 Theatre School Welcome to the renewed Theatre School! Started in 2019, ROHM Theatre Kyoto's 'Theatre School' will now feature two courses: 'Deep Dive into Theatre!' and 'Challenge New Expressions!'. With artists active domestically and internationally as instructors, participants will use their bodies, think, and work together to 'create' in various fields of expression. Additionally, a stage staff workshop will be held with ROHM Theatre Kyoto staff as instructors. 【Event Information】 - Deep Dive into Theatre! Course Experience the creative process of theatre by collecting interesting things from everyday scenes, writing a script, directing, and acting. Instructor: Takuya Murakawa (Director) Dates: July 27 (Mon) - 31 (Fri), 13:00 - approx. 18:00 *Mini-performance on the last day. Instructor's Comment: 'I want to start creating from 'closely watching and listening' to things around you. I hope to share with you a method of creating theatre from discoveries, encounters, and coincidences.' Takuya Murakawa Director. Presents works using documentary and fieldwork methods in various fields. His pieces, born on the border of fiction and reality, explore what raw reality is. Major works include 'Zeitgeber' (2011-), 'Moonlight' (2018), and the stage version of 'Tennis' (2025). His play 'Jiken' received a special award at the 21st AAF Drama Awards in 2022. ■ Challenge New Expressions! Course Discover new ways of seeing and feeling by observing your body, objects, and places, and experience the process of creating your own new expression using your body, video, and installations. Instructors: Pijin Neji (Dancer/Choreographer), Michiko Tsuda (Artist) Dates: Aug 18 (Tue) - 22 (Sat) *Mini-performance on the last day. Pijin Neji's Comment: 'Let's create 'choreography' that guides movement based on observations and discoveries. We aim to generate new movements.' Michiko Tsuda's Comment: 'Let's observe a familiar space and capture our own world. Let's face ourselves through video and move our bodies.' Pijin Neji Dancer/Choreographer. Formerly a member of the Butoh company 'Dairakudakan.' He presents works focusing on the body's state, born from the interplay of voice and movement. Recent works include the trilogy 'Corona Report' and 'Seisei no Sensei' with YCAM. He considers 'choreography' as something that guides the emergence of movement.
